+package org.graalvm.compiler.core.test;
+
+import org.graalvm.compiler.debug.DebugContext;
+import org.graalvm.compiler.nodes.FrameState;
+import org.graalvm.compiler.nodes.StructuredGraph;
+import org.graalvm.compiler.nodes.StructuredGraph.AllowAssumptions;
+import org.graalvm.compiler.nodes.util.GraphUtil;
+import org.graalvm.compiler.phases.common.CanonicalizerPhase;
+import org.graalvm.compiler.phases.tiers.PhaseContext;
+import org.junit.Test;
+
+public class PushThroughIfTest extends GraalCompilerTest {
+
+ public int field1;
+ public int field2;
+
+ public int testSnippet(boolean b) {
+ int i;
+ if (b) {
+ i = field1;
+ } else {
+ i = field1;
+ }
+ return i + field2;
+ }
+
+ @SuppressWarnings("unused")
+ public int referenceSnippet(boolean b) {
+ return field1 + field2;
+ }
+
+ @Test
+ public void test1() {
+ test("testSnippet", "referenceSnippet");
+ }
+
+ private void test(String snippet, String reference) {
+ StructuredGraph graph = parseEager(snippet, AllowAssumptions.YES);
+ DebugContext debug = graph.getDebug();
+ debug.dump(DebugContext.BASIC_LEVEL, graph, "Graph");
+ for (FrameState fs : graph.getNodes(FrameState.TYPE).snapshot()) {
+ fs.replaceAtUsages(null);
+ GraphUtil.killWithUnusedFloatingInputs(fs);
+ }
+ new CanonicalizerPhase().apply(graph, new PhaseContext(getProviders()));
+ new CanonicalizerPhase().apply(graph, new PhaseContext(getProviders()));
+
+ StructuredGraph referenceGraph = parseEager(reference, AllowAssumptions.YES);
+ for (FrameState fs : referenceGraph.getNodes(FrameState.TYPE).snapshot()) {
+ fs.replaceAtUsages(null);
+ GraphUtil.killWithUnusedFloatingInputs(fs);
+ }
+ new CanonicalizerPhase().apply(referenceGraph, new PhaseContext(getProviders()));
+ assertEquals(referenceGraph, graph);
+ }
+}
